  • What does "buy" mean in VIG activity?

    "Buy" means an investor increased their reported position in VIG compared to the prior reporting period. This reflects growing exposure to VANGUARD DIVIDEND APPREC ETF (VIG) rather than necessarily a brand-new position (though new positions also appear as buys when prior quantity was zero).
